US embassy concludes ‘The Art of the Deal’ leadership, negotiation training in Dhaka
The United States Embassy in Dhaka has concluded a four-day training program titled “The Art of the Deal: American Excellence in Negotiation Skills,” aimed at enhancing leadership, communication and negotiation capabilities among Bangladeshi youth.
The closing ceremony was held on Sunday (June 7) at Hotel Six Seasons in the capital, with US Ambassador to Bangladesh Brent T. Christensen attending as the chief guest.
According to a press release issued by the embassy, the training was conducted with support from US English Language Specialist Joan Munisteri and brought together 60 alumni of the Access English Programme from Dhaka, Chattogram and Sylhet.
During the four-day workshop, participants received intensive training on negotiation strategies, leadership development and effective communication. The curriculum incorporated key principles from The Art of the Deal alongside American approaches to negotiation, decision-making and leadership.
Addressing the closing session, Ambassador Christensen congratulated the participants and encouraged them to apply the skills acquired through the program in their academic, professional and leadership pursuits.
Organisers said the initiative reflects the US Embassy’s continued commitment to empowering young Bangladeshis through skill development, leadership training and educational exchange opportunities.
They added that similar programmes will continue in the future to help foster globally competitive leadership among the country’s youth.
